Abstract:
DDIs have important implications for managed care. They can adversely impact patient outcomes and can also have serious cost implications. The problem posed by unintended and adverse DDIs will continue to grow in importance as the complexity and uniqueness of medication regimens escalate in an aging population using increasingly sophisticated and varied pharmacological agents. In this paper, antidepressants and SSRIs in particular were used to illustrate these important points.
